What Is a VA Loan?
A VA loan is a type of mortgage backed by the U.S. Department of Veterans Affairs, designed to make homeownership more accessible to service members, veterans, and eligible surviving spouses. These loans offer unique advantages, such as no down payment, no monthly private mortgage insurance (PMI), and competitive interest rates.
Why Get Preapproved for a VA Home Loan?
Getting preapproved for a VA home loan clarifies your budget, strengthens your offer to sellers, and prepares you for a smoother closing. A pre-approval letter signals that your finances have been reviewed and that you’re a serious buyer—especially valuable in Colorado’s competitive real estate market.
Eligibility for VA Loan in Colorado
Understanding your eligibility for VA loan benefits is essential. You may qualify if you meet one of the following service conditions:
- 90 consecutive days of wartime active service
- 181 days of peacetime active service
- 6 years in the National Guard or Reserves
- Surviving spouse of a service member who died in service or from a service-connected disability
Note: While VA mortgage loans remove many traditional barriers, lenders still assess credit score, debt-to-income (DTI) ratio, and VA residual income to confirm affordability.
